Gruppen



"Gruppen", a Karlheinz Stockhausen 's piece for 3 orchestras created in 1958 in Köln....

A large orchestra of 109 players is divided into three orchestral units, each with its own conductor, which are deployed in a horseshoe shape to the left, front, and right of the audience. 

"...in Gruppen … whole envelopes of rhythmic blocks are exact lines of mountains that I saw in Paspels in Switzerland right in front of my little window. Many of the time spectra, which are represented by superimpositions of different rhythmic layers—of different speeds in each layer—their envelope which describes the increase and decrease of the number of layers, their shape, so to speak, the shape of the time field, are the curves of the mountain's contour which I saw when I looked out the window..."  K.S. ( Cott 1973, 141)

Città notte


The proloific italian composer Egisto Macchi, who joined with Ennio Morricone the Gruppo di Improvvisazione di Nuova Consonanza in the late 60s, founded the IRTEM  for musical theater researches and the "Sound Archive for Contemporary music".
He wrote several music for movies (Padre Padrone, The assassination of Trotsky ... ) and described his music as "dionysian".

Som Sakrifis


Formed of a trio including Coto K on contrabass, cellist Nikos Veliotis and ILIOS on oscillators, the greek band Mohammad is playing long form drone pieces.
Their new album "Som Sakrifis" is out on PAN

Morteza Mahjubi


     Tehran Radio Station in Arg Square LTR: Marziyeh Morteza Mahjubi, Adib Khansari in 1972

Morteza Mahjubi (1900 - 1965) is an iranian composer and a piano player who played in the gatherings of the iranian aristocracy.
